  1. Cote D’Ivoire

  2. Was First Colonized as a French territory (officially in 1893) By 1960 France granted them Independence and named Felix Houphouet-Boigny president Was Peaceful until 2002 when civil war broke Independence

  3. Positives • Created wealth • Spread economic growth • French control = national security • Negatives • Since gaining independence, periods of “popular unrest” • Civil war Imperialism’s Effects

  4. Held election in December, 2010 • Incumbent, Laurent Gbagbo, refuses to step down • Challenger, AlassaneOuattara, has barricaded himself with protection from UN • Gbagbo has ordered UN and French peacekeepers to leave the country immediately • Over 200 people have died since the election and attacks on civilians are frequent Current Issues
